Zibby Talks About Her Family's Recent Losses

In this short, heartfelt, tearjerker of an episode (you might need some Kleenex), Zibby shares her own thoughts and feelings during a tragic time. Her husband Kyle’s mother, Susan Felice Owens, and grandmother Marie (“Nene”) Felice, both passed away recently from COVID. This is Zibby's direct outreach to podcast listeners to share what she’s been going through and to hopefully help those who have lost anyone they have loved, too…. Aug 31, 2020 • 30min

Sara Schaefer, GRAND

Sara Schaefer talked to Zibby about Grand, an honest, witty, and vulnerable memoir. They talked about family scandal, reflecting on childhood, moral anxiety, and whitewater rafting in the Grand Canyon. Hosted on Acast. See acast.com/privacy for more information.
